Key Factors to Consider Before Buying
Before clicking "Add to Basket," purchasers need to examine a number of vital aspects to ensure the treadmill matches their particular requirements:
- Available Space & & Storage: Measure the room before buying. Consider whether the maker needs to fold vertically (hydraulic help) or lie flat under furniture.
- Motor Power (HP/CHP): Walkers can get away with a 1.5 to 2.0 HP motor. Joggers and runners require at least 2.5 CHP to ensure the motor does not strain or stutter under constant foot strikes.
- Running Deck Dimensions: Taller users or quick runners need a longer (a minimum of 130cm) and wider (a minimum of 45cm) belt to prevent stepping off the edge.
- Cushioning: Outdoor running on pavement is extreme on knees and ankles. Search for treadmills with elastomer cushioning or air pods to reduce joint effect.
- Max User Weight: Always check the manufacturer's weight limit to ensure stability and durability.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How much space do I require for a home treadmill?
Normally, you should designate a footprint of approximately 180cm x 80cm for the device itself, plus an additional 1 to 2 meters of clearance area behind the treadmill for safety in case of slips or falls.
2. Do I need a subscription to utilize a home treadmill?
No. While brand names like NordicTrack greatly promote their iFit membership services, practically all treadmills have a "Manual Mode" that works completely offline without paying monthly charges. Pre-set programs are likewise developed into the console.
3. Will a treadmill damage my floor covering or interrupt next-door neighbors?
Running generates vibration and noise that can take a trip through ceilings. It is highly advised to purchase a heavy-duty rubber treadmill mat. This safeguards wood or carpeted floors, lowers vibration noise for downstairs next-door neighbors, and avoids dust from getting into the motor.
